Maximizing Your Fitting Experience

Bridal alterations at Lily Bridal and More are an essential step to ensure your gown looks flawless on the wedding day. These appointments can require several visits, during which the consultant will carefully examine the gown’s overall fit and detailed adjustments such as sleeve length, neckline, and train modifications. Always bring the undergarments and shoes you intend to wear on your big day, as they influence the gown’s length. Honest and open feedback is necessary to ensure that final alterations enhance your comfort and style. This process requires attention and allows you to enjoy the moment as your gown is tailored to your ideal specifications.

Understanding Gown Alterations

Even the most exquisite gowns rarely fit perfect straight off the rack. Alterations at Lily Bridal and More are designed to refine the gown to your body, ensuring a comfortable fit. This process can include adjustments such as hems, sleeves, trains, or detailed refinements like beading placement. The consultant will guide you through each stage, checking the gown while you walk to ensure the final look enhances your figure. Clear feedback throughout the process guarantees that your gown will be perfectly tailored and ideal for your wedding day.
